Family Outraged as DA Decides Not to Charge Mother of Accused Killer in Alexis Gabe Case

(KRON) — The Contra Costa County District Lawyer’s Workplace introduced Thursday that the mom of the person accused of killing Alexis Gabe is not going to face fees. Gabe’s household informed KRON4 it’s “extremely disappointed” within the choice.

Gabe was an Oakley lady who was discovered to be useless after she was initially reported lacking in 2022. Gabe’s ex-boyfriend, Marshall Curtis Jones, was charged with Gabe’s homicide. Gabe was final seen on Jan. 26, 2022. Jones was killed by police in Washington state in June of 2022.

The DA’s workplace investigated whether or not Jones’ mom, Alicia Coleman-Clark, acted as an adjunct after the actual fact in reference to Gabe’s homicide. Gabe’s household met with police in December, and the Oakley and Antioch Police Departments pursued leads.

Authorities investigated recovered clothes and tried to find a plastic bag containing Gabe’s stays. The bag had been present in Amador County and was despatched to Chico State for forensic testing, however police have been by no means in a position to get their arms on the bag.

In addition they interviewed Coleman-Clark’s boyfriend and sought details about whether or not she helped Jones fly to Washington.

The DA’s workplace stated “some information raised suspicion about Alicia Coleman-Clark’s potential culpability as an accessory after the fact,” however they might not discover ample proof to cost her.

A timeline put collectively by police detectives confirmed that Jones travelled to Coleman-Clark’s home a number of instances within the days after he allegedly dedicated the homicide. He flew to Seattle on Feb. 2 to stick with his father.

Coleman-Clark was briefly detained on Might 19 on suspicion of aiding and abetting, however she was not charged. The DA stated in August of 2022 that she wouldn’t cost Coleman-Clark. She later initiated one other investigation.

Gabe’s household despatched KRON4 the next assertion relating to the choice to not cost Coleman-Clark:

“We’re extraordinarily dissatisfied. We simply concluded a dialog with DA Diana Becton and Deputy DA Simon O’Connell. Regardless of having a considerable quantity of proof, they nonetheless declined to pursue fees.”
